#482CAE Hex Color Code

#482CAE

The Hexadecimal Color #482CAE is a contrast shade of Dark Slate Blue. #482CAE RGB value is rgb(72, 44, 174). RGB Color Model of #482CAE consists of 28% red, 17% green and 68% blue. HSL color Mode of #482CAE has 253°(degrees) Hue, 60% Saturation and 43% Lightness. #482CAE color has an wavelength of 460.7037n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#482CAE is #6633CC.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#482CAE is #43A. The Closest Color to #482CAE is #483D8B. Official Name of #482CAE Hex Code is Daisy Bush.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#482CAE is 59 Cyan 75 Magenta 0 Yellow 32 Black and #482CAE CMY is 59, 75, 0.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#482CAE is hsl(253,60,43,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(253, 75, 68).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#482CAE is 11.21, 6.23, 40.65.
Hex8 Value of #482CAE is #482CAEFF. Decimal Value of #482CAE is 4730030 and Octal Value of #482CAE is 22026256. Binary Value of #482CAE is 1001000, 101100, 10101110 and Android of #482CAE is 4282920110 / 0xff482cae.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#482CAE is 0.193, 0.107, 0.107 and YIQ Color Space of #482CAE is 67.192, -25.0838, 46.378.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#482CAE is 4.29, 2.94, 40.09.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#482CAE is 29.99, 46.99, -64.73.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#482CAE is 29.99, 0.01, -86.12.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#482CAE is 29.99, 79.99, 305.98. Hunter Lab variable of #482CAE is 24.96, 36.49, -79.09.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#482CAE

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
